Action Items - FY12 |
|
District Instructional Technology equipment budget $50,000: Epson Brightlink 475WI projectors for middle school math classrooms. Click here for the details. |
| Capital Improvement Funds $75,000: Replace two computer labs (Northeast Elementary School and Plympton Elementary School) and all teacher computers in high school math classrooms. |
|
Title 1 ARRA funded the following projects for Title 1 elementary schools: Plympton Elementary School - ENO boards with ShortThrow LCD projectors with new computers in 15 classrooms. ELMO document cameras in 3 classrooms. Stanley Elementary School - ENO boards with ShortThrow LCD projectors and ELMO document cameras with new computers in 17 classrooms. Whittemore Elementary School - ENO boards and ELMO document cameras in 21 classrooms. |
